Previously, we have used a 300,000 pixel camera with a pixel resolution of 30μm per pixel.
I tried to simulate it.
Now, if you want to detect a larger defect size
For example, suppose you want to detect a defect of 0.5 [mm square],
0.5 [mm square] ÷ 4 [pixel square] = 1 pixel resolution 0.125 [mm] (125 [μm])
FIELD OF VIEW IN X DIRECTION
0.125 [mm/pixel] = X [mm] ÷ 640 [pixels].
X = 80.0 [mm].
FIELD OF VIEW IN Y DIRECTION
0.125 [mm/pixel] = Y [mm] ÷ 480 [pixels].
Y = 60.0 [mm].
This means that objects with a field of view up to 80 × 60 mm in size can be detected.
In this way, "I want to detect defects within a field of view of ●● mm and a corner of ●● mm".
The camera will be selected.
The camera used for the ping pong method at the exhibition was a 300,000 pixel camera, though,
The specifications are as follows, with some safety in mind.
1 pixel resolution: 36μm
Field of view : 24 × 18mm
Minimum detectable size : 0.2 mm square
